## Configuration

GateCount reads its settings from a `.env` file in the service root. Most defaults work out of the box for the Brindlewick Arena deployment, including poll intervals and turnstile zone mappings. The only value you must supply yourself is the relay token used to authenticate with the Pellmore counting hub. Add the following line to your `.env` file:

sealed setting: VAULT_KEY20=c8ea1e419912889df6b4

## Getting Started: String Extraction with lexpull

Plugin authors for the Murmuration platform must run the lexpull script before submitting a release. It scans your plugin source, extracts translatable strings, and uploads them to the Lingate staging catalog. First-time runs require initializing your local credential store; lexpull will prompt you to restore it. When prompted, enter the recovery passphrase, which is provided below.

unlock words, yawig-kagef: gordor-holvan-ulaael-pramir-ulaiel-tamdor

**Ticket: Planner regression — Corvid query tier**

Latency spike on analytic queries since Monday. Planner on replica set B is using old cardinality hints; primary was updated, replicas weren't. Classic drift — someone edited the primary's config in place. Fix: sync replicas, then restart planners in order. The primary's current planner settings, for reference, are as follows.

config for tawif-bagef:
[sorwyn]
team = sorys
access_code = ac_9ba40c
host = sorwyn.ordingrid.local
port = 5000
owner = aldok.quenion
peer = belath.paliqcloud.local

Quick note for support: we finished moving the old cron jobs into the Quillrunner workflow engine this week. If a customer reports a stale nightly digest, don't restart the cron box — it's gone. Check the Quillrunner dashboard for the failed step and retry from there. When escalating, include the trace token shown at the top of the run page.

pipeline stamp: htk9_ce63042d9